The Quattro iPhone 3G Case, made by Japanese company Factron, is one of the first hardware add-ons to mount onto the iPhone camera externally. While you can find a number of apps to create effects for images, the lenses from Factron do the job at the hardware level. The case is made of aircraft grade duralumin with a lustrous polished-silver finish. Its back is enclosed in supple calf leather. But the real attraction is the list of mountable lenses which include options like fish-eyes, macros, wide angles and superwide conversions. Its compound metallic frame is designed to give it a classy Victorian look. This iPhone case is available for $200.
